PUF物理不可克隆功能筑牢硬件安全防线

作者:很酷cat2024.11.26 13:31浏览量:52

简介:PUF技术利用芯片制造过程中的物理差异为每块芯片生成唯一身份标识,实现硬件安全。该技术具有防克隆、防篡改等特性,广泛应用于芯片安全、物联网安全等领域,为终端设备提供高级别安全保障。

PUF,即Physical Unclonable Functions(物理不可克隆功能),是一种前沿的硬件安全技术。它利用硅基半导体在制造过程中因工艺波动而产生的固有属性差异,如路径时延、晶体管阈值电压等,提取出不可克隆的物理特征,作为每块芯片的唯一身份标识符,类似于生物的指纹。这种技术为物理芯片提供了数字指纹,是在资源受限的电子设备上实现硬件安全的一种重要解决方案。

PUF技术的原理与特性

PUF技术的核心在于其唯一性和随机性。在硅基芯片制造过程中,由于半导体制程的微小变化,每块芯片的物理特性都会有所不同。这些差异在电子特性上表现为微小的但可测量的变化,使得每块芯片都独一无二。PUF技术正是利用这种不可预测的随机分布,为每个芯片生成一个唯一的识别码,即“芯片指纹”。

PUF技术具有多项显著特性,包括稳定性、随机性、独特性、防篡改性、数学不可克隆性和物理不可克隆性。这些特性使得PUF技术成为硬件安全领域的佼佼者。它不仅能够为芯片提供唯一的身份标识,还能够实现私钥不存储、根密钥内生、身份与硬件绑定等核心价值,有效提升了硬件设备的安全性。

PUF技术的分类与应用

PUF技术按照实现方法可分为非电子PUF、模拟电路PUF和数字电路PUF。其中,数字电路PUF是目前应用最为广泛的一种。它主要包括基于存储器的PUF(如SRAM PUF)、基于仲裁器的PUF、基于环形振荡器的PUF等。

SRAM PUF利用存储器单元结构的稳定状态,在制造过程中因制造变化差异而产生的双稳态逻辑单元,在不稳定状态向稳定状态转化时有其明确偏向,从而提取出唯一的PUF值。仲裁PUF则通过测量同一信号在芯片内不同路径上的传播延迟差异来生成唯一的响应。环形振荡器PUF则是利用环形振荡器电路的频率差异来生成唯一的PUF值。

PUF技术的应用领域广泛,包括芯片安全、物联网安全、防伪识别、知识产权保护等。在芯片安全领域,PUF技术能够为芯片提供唯一的身份标识和安全密钥生成功能,有效防止克隆和篡改攻击。在物联网安全领域,PUF技术能够为终端设备提供高级别的安全保障,实现端到端的信任能力。此外,PUF技术还能够应用于防伪识别和知识产权保护等领域,为产品的真伪鉴别和知识产权的保护提供有力支持。

PUF技术的实践案例

中国移动旗下芯昇科技有限公司推出的高安全MCU芯片CM32Sxx系列,就采用了PUF技术。通过使用南京帕孚信息科技有限公司的SoftPUF开发工具包,在芯片中集成了物理不可克隆功能(PUF),实现了芯片唯一身份标识和安全密钥生成等关键功能。这些特性使得CM32Sxx系列芯片具有防克隆、防篡改、抗物理攻击以及侧信道攻击的能力,为物联网场景下的终端设备提供了高级别的安全保障。

此外,帕孚信息科技有限公司作为自主可控的PUF软硬件产品及解决方案提供商,专注于PUF物理不可克隆技术,致力于为客户提供专业、可靠、高性价比的PUF产品及解决方案。其产品与解决方案已在半导体、物联网等多个领域得到广泛应用,并与中国移动、中国联通、国家电网等国内多家行业领军企业建立了深度合作关系。

结论

综上所述,PUF物理不可克隆功能作为一种前沿的硬件安全技术,具有独特的优势和广泛的应用前景。它能够为芯片和终端设备提供唯一的身份标识和安全密钥生成功能,有效防止克隆和篡改攻击。随着大数据、区块链等新技术的快速发展,PUF技术将在物联网安全领域发挥更加重要的作用。未来,我们可以期待PUF技术在更多领域得到应用和推广,为构建更加安全的数字世界贡献力量。

在选择与PUF技术相关的产品时,曦灵数字人作为一个能够与PUF技术相结合的产品,可以展现出其在硬件安全方面的独特价值。曦灵数字人作为一种先进的数字人技术,能够结合PUF技术的安全特性,为数字人提供更高的安全保障。例如,在数字人的身份验证和访问控制方面,可以利用PUF技术的唯一性和不可克隆性来确保数字人的身份真实性和安全性。同时,在数字人的数据传输和存储过程中,也可以利用PUF技术的安全密钥生成功能来加密和保护数据的安全。因此,曦灵数字人与PUF技术的结合将为数字人领域带来更加安全、可靠的解决方案。